DUCAL EXTRAVAGANCE OVER PROPHETS Says a Washington diplomat The late duke of Devonshire took a calm and ducal Interest In the races There was a certain sporting paper that kept a large staff of prophet and always prophesied the outcome of important races The duke put great reliances in these prophets Ho always roail the paper and he continually recommended It to bis friends But once at Goodwood at the days end a man came up to the duke and said What of your paper now Did you see It this morning Six prophets prophesied that six different horses would win and here only seven ran and the winner was the seventh which no prophet had se ¬ lected Well what have you to say now All I have to say thw duke answered calmly Is that theres room for another prophet on that paper
